The Tshikalange family of Muledane is desperately looking for their beloved mother, Thinavhuyo Agnes Tshikalange. According to police information, Tshikalange (47) went missing after being sent to Ha Sundani by her family for spiritual assistance on her illness on 5 May 2010. Tshikalange, who is a mental patient, was staying with her daughter at Muledane. It is alleged that she always had her hands and feet chained to prevent her from straying. On 5 May 2010, between 22:00 and 02:00, the mental patient attended a church prayer as usual and went to sleep. By early morning, other patients were surprised to find that she was not in her room. One of the patients confirmed seeing her going out of her room at about 04:00 the following morning. She is of medium height, with a slender body and light in complexion. She was last seen wearing a red ladies check skirt, brown t-shirt, blue running shoes and a black hair net.
